
Faisal Siddiqi, MD
Dr. Siddiqi completed his medical residency at the prestigious Yale New Haven Hospital. He subsequently pursued his interest in cardiology at the University of Maryland and graduated with competencies for clinical cardiology, echocardiography, and nuclear cardiology. During this time, he also developed a commitment for cardiac electrophysiology and pursued research interests in arrhythmia-related disorders. His work gained recognition in peer-reviewed publications and was presented at national academic conferences.
Dr. Siddiqi went on to specialize in arrhythmia management, completing a two-year fellowship in clinical cardiac electrophysiology at New York Presbyterian Hospital-Cornell Campus, where he honed his skills for minimally invasive electrophysiology procedures with cutting-edge technology under the direction of world-renowned cardiac electrophysiologists.
Dr. Siddiqi now specializes in the treatment of a myriad of arrhythmia conditions, including brady-arrhythmias, cardiac resynchronization, pacemaker and defibrillator implantation, supraventricular tachycardias, ventricular tachycardias, and atrial fibrillation. He also specializes in lead management and performs highly specialized laser-assisted cardiac extraction procedures. He is a member of the Heart Rhythm Society, American College of Cardiology and is distinguished as a Fellow of the American College of Cardiology (FACC). Dr. Siddiqi is Board Certified in internal medicine, clinical cardiology, and cardiac electrophysiology.
Moreover, Dr. Siddiqi is a strong proponent of keeping abreast with the latest advancements in the field. His current interests include left atrial appendage closure using the Watchman device, subcutaneous ICD implantation, and His-Bundle pacing for more physiologic pacemaker therapy. He will also be taking a primary role at Our Lady of Lourdes Hospital in the offering of miniaturized pacemakers delivered percutaneously via a minimally invasive approach.
Dr. Siddiqi prides himself on his patient care and attention to detail. Each patient is treated as an individual and the appropriate treatment plan is uniquely tailored to best serve the patient.
